Free Audiobooks for Teens, ALL SUMMER

From April 28 – August 10 2022,  SYNC gives you two free titles every week. (See titles here)

How do you get them?

  1. Register here and follow the instructions
  2. Download Sora from the Apple App Store or Google Play Store, or go to soraapp.com in your browser.
  3. If you’ve never used Sora before, do this:
  • In Sora, tap I have a setup code (at the bottom of the screen).
  • Enter this setup code: audiobooksync.
  • Enter the email address you used to sign up for SYNC.
  • Tap Explore (the binoculars at the bottom of the screen) to see the week’s featured titles [SYNC 2021 starts April 29].
  1. If you already use Sora, do this:
  • In Sora, open the menu (in the top-right corner).
  • Select Add a library.
  • Search for audiobooksync and select the library from the results.
  • Enter the email address you used to sign up for SYNC

New titles will be available each Thursday at midnight Eastern time (i.e., 12:01am ET). You can access the titles for 7 days, until the next Wednesday at 11:59pm. You MUST download the titles you want when they are available. Otherwise, they’re gone.

First Chapter Friday – The Screaming Staircase

Listen to the first chapter of The Screaming Staircase, by Jonathan Stroud here. If you’d like to read the rest of it, check it out at the Skyview library, or it’s available as an audiobook and eBook on both the KPBSD digital library and the Alaska digital library (through Sora). Listen to other first chapters in the virtual reading room.

Genre: Fantasy fiction, scary

About the book: When London is overrun by malevolent spirits, a talented group of young psychic detectives compete against other ghostbusting agencies in the debut of a new series that finds three intrepid colleagues investigating one of England’s most haunted houses.
